Philadelphia Eagles practice was originally scheduled to be open to the media today on Monday, June 1 but that is no longer the case.
Media availability has been moved to tomorrow, Tuesday, June 2. The reason for the delay is due to pending thunderstorms in the Philadelphia area.
This obviously means that there will be no practice notes and/or quotes today.

In any case, as a reminder, here's a look at the remaining Eagles offseason workout schedule. It's worth noting all of these events are voluntary save for the mandatory minicamp taking place from June 16-18.
OTA Offseason Workouts: June 2, June 4, June 8-11.
Mandatory Minicamp: June 16-18.
BGN Coverage: The following practices are open to the media: June 2, June 8, June 9, and June 16-18.
